Right choice is (B) Any part of a PLANT TAKEN out and grown in a test tube

To elaborate: It was learnt by scientists, during the 1950s, that whole plants could be regenerated from explants, i.e., any part of the plant taken out and grown in a test tube, under sterile conditions in a special nutrient MEDIUM.
